Clarity on BPO taxation laws sought |
|
August, 29th 2006 |
The Associated Chambers of Commerce and Industry has urged the Finance Ministry to clarify provisions of taxation on profits earned outside India by the Indian BPO Industry.
According to the chamber any ambiguity on BPO taxation laws, particularly in the case of tax on profits earned outside India at times when Indian BPO units are providing services to their overseas counterpart on a temporary basis, would create confusion.
Therefore, the chamber has sought clarification in this regard, suggesting the Central Board of Direct Taxes to bring out a specific circular.
